/**
 * 

This {@link AtmosphereInterceptor} implementation automatically suspends the intercepted * {@link AtmosphereResource} and takes care of managing the response's state (flushing, resuming, * etc.) when a {@link org.atmosphere.cpr.Broadcaster#broadcast} is invoked. When used, {@link org.atmosphere.cpr.AtmosphereHandler} implementations no longer need to make calls to * {@link AtmosphereResource#suspend}. *

* If your application doesn't use {@link org.atmosphere.cpr.Broadcaster}, this interceptor will not work and you need to programmatically * resume, flush, etc. *

*

By default, intercepted {@link AtmosphereResource} instances are suspended when a GET * request is received. You can change the triggering http method by configuring * {@link org.atmosphere.cpr.ApplicationConfig#ATMOSPHERERESOURCE_INTERCEPTOR_METHOD} *

*

*

Use this class when you don't want to manage the suspend/resume operation from your * particular Atmosphere framework implementation classes ({@link org.atmosphere.cpr.AtmosphereHandler}, * {@link org.atmosphere.websocket.WebSocketHandler}, or * {@link org.atmosphere.cpr.Meteor} instances) or extensions (GWT, Jersey, Wicket, etc...) *

* For this mechanism to work properly, each client must set the * {@link org.atmosphere.cpr.HeaderConfig#X_ATMOSPHERE_TRANSPORT} header.
